Hey everyone,

I have a 3rd gen ipod, and my girlfriend just bought a 5th gen. I was messing around with it, and noticed that if for a certain artist you don't have any albums, then it will go right from artist to song. (this is not a big problem, I still like how the 3rd gen does it though)

However, say you have 1 album listed, and then a few songs (with no album) all by the same artist, then when you click artist on the ipod, it goes right to the only album, and you can't access the "un-albumed" songs. I know this may sound a little confusing... but can anyone help me (and her) figure out how to fix this? Is the only option putting all the songs with albums? I put all the albumless songs under an album titled "Various", but there must be an easier way...
